TRIMBLE STANDARD INTERFACE PROTOCOL (TSIP)<br />

TSIP Packet 0xBC is used to set the communication parameters on port A. The table<br />

below lists the individual fields within the Packet 0xBC and provides query field<br />

descriptions. The BC command settings are retained in battery-backed RAM.<br />

Note – The Copernicus GPS receiver requires that the input and output baud rates be<br />

identical.<br />

Command Packet 0xC0 - Graceful Shutdown and Go To Standby Mode<br />

TSIP Packet 0xC0 is used to issue a reset or graceful shutdown to the unit and/or<br />

command the unit into Standby Mode.<br />
